NDT makes it possible to examine materials, components, and welded joints without damaging or affecting their continued usability. The methods are used, among other things, in manufacturing, installation, maintenance, repair, and periodic inspection.
NDT methods
Our NDT services include the following methods within the applicable accreditation scope:
Visual Testing (VT)
Visual testing is often the first step in the inspection of welds, components, and structures. The method is used to identify visible deviations such as cracks, corrosion, deformations, and weld defects.
Magnetic particle testing (MT)
Magnetic particle testing is used to detect cracks and other surface and near-surface flaws in ferromagnetic materials. The method is used, among other things, for the inspection of welds, steel structures, and machine components.
Liquid Penetrant Testing (PT)
Penetrant testing is used to detect small cracks, pores, and other defects open to the surface. The method can be used on many non-porous materials and is particularly useful where magnetic particle testing is not possible, such as on stainless steel and aluminum.
PT is used, among other things, for the inspection of welds, cast and machined components, and pressure equipment.
Ultrasonic Testing (UT)
Ultrasound is used to detect and assess flaws inside materials and welded joints. The technique is also used for thickness measurement and condition monitoring of components subjected to, for example, corrosion or erosion.
Radiographic Testing (RT)
Radiographic testing is used to inspect welded joints and components using X-rays or gamma radiation. The method makes it possible to detect internal defects and provides a documented result that can be reviewed and saved for future follow-up.
RT is used, among other things, for the inspection of welded joints, pipe systems, pressure equipment, and cast components.
PAUT – Advanced technology as part of daily NDT operations
Phased Array Ultrasonic Testing (PAUT) is an advanced ultrasonic testing technique that provides detailed information about welds and components and enables both the detection, positioning, and evaluation of indications.
At Inspekt, we have long had the ambition to make PAUT more accessible to our customers and a natural part of modern NDT operations.
PAUT should not only be a method for the largest or most complicated projects. By building competence, equipment, and local availability, we can use the technology even in routine industrial operations where it provides a better technical and commercial alternative.
Depending on the application, PAUT can provide, among other things:
- high detection capability and detailed information about indications
- digital and traceable documentation
- effective inspection of welded joints
- ability to investigate complex geometries
- an alternative to radiography in certain applications
- better basis for assessment and continued operation

More NDT and material inspection services
TOFD – Time of Flight Diffraction
TOFD is an ultrasonic technique with high accuracy in detecting and sizing discontinuities. The method is often used together with PAUT when inspecting critical welded joints and pressure equipment.
TFM – Total Focusing Method
TFM is a further development in advanced ultrasonic testing that can create high-resolution images of materials and welded joints. The technique can be used for complex inspection tasks where detailed information about indications is important.
PMI – Positive Material Identification
PMI is used to verify material composition and ensure that the correct material has been used.
With portable equipment, materials can be identified directly on-site without the need to dismantle the component. PMI is used, for example, on piping systems, valves, flanges, pressure vessels, welding materials, and other components where correct material grade is critical.
Eddy Current Testing (ET)
ET is used to detect surface and near-surface defects in electrically conductive materials. The method is suitable for, among other things, the inspection of tubes, heat exchangers, and other components where high sensitivity and efficient testing are required.
Corrosion mapping and scanning
Corrosion mapping
Individual thickness measurements provide information about the material at a specific point. When a larger area needs to be assessed, Inspekt can instead use corrosion mapping to create a more detailed picture of the material's actual condition.
Through systematic or automated ultrasonic measurement, we can map variations in wall thickness and identify localized corrosion, erosion, and material loss.
The result can be presented as a digital thickness map and provide the customer with a better basis for, for example, continued operation, repair, maintenance, and future follow-up.
Bottom and wall scanning of cisterns and tanks
Inspekt performs scanning and thickness mapping of tank bottoms, storage tank walls, and other large surfaces.
By collecting a large number of measurement points, we can create a significantly more comprehensive picture of the structure's condition than with traditional spot measurements. The method can identify areas of localized material loss and help the client focus further investigations and measures where they are actually needed.
Quality assured NDT in Sweden and Norway
Sweden – Accredited NDT according to ISO/IEC 17025
Inspekt Sweden AB NDT operations are accredited by SWEDAC in accordance with SS-EN ISO/IEC 17025.
The accreditation entails an independent assessment of our competence to perform the testing activities included in our accredited scope. The requirements include, among other things, staff competence, equipment, testing methods, calibration, documentation, and quality assurance.
The accreditation applies to the methods, standards, and applications specified by Inspekt Sweden AB. current scope of accreditation.
Norway – NDT according to ISO 9001 and established NDT requirements
Inspekt Norway AS performs NDT within the framework of a quality management system certified according to ISO 9001.
The work is carried out according to documented procedures and applicable standards by qualified and certified NDT personnel. Depending on the assignment, industry, and customer requirements, we work in accordance with relevant requirements within, among others, ISO 9712, Nordtest, and applicable product and testing standards.
It provides our customers with a structured and quality-assured NDT delivery with clear processes for competence, equipment, execution, reporting, and documentation.
